Sit back and relax as you travel by air-conditioned coach from London to the UNESCO World Heritage-listed city of Bath. On your way, discover the iconic prehistoric stone formation of Stonehenge. Spend a full afternoon exploring Bath, and take advantage of the opportunity to see the ancient Roman Baths or the Jane Austen Visitor Centre.

Departure point
Located on 164 Buckingham Palace Road, Victoria, London, SW1W 9TP, approximately 7 minute walk from Victoria Underground and Railway station. Tour departs inside the building at Gate 19 at 8:15am (Boarding starts at 8:00am)Redemption
Boarding starts at 8:00am. Please go to Premium Tours desk located at Gate 19 inside Victoria Coach Station and wait for the tour to be called (Tour 8). For the safety of all customers, Victoria Coach Station departure gate(s) close 5 minutes before the departure time stated.
